Choosing the right fillets

When choosing the right fillets for your air fryer tilapia, there are a few things to keep in mind. Firstly, you can use either fresh or frozen tilapia fillets, although fresh is always preferable if available. Fresh fillets will give you a better texture and flavour, but frozen fillets are a convenient option that still work well in the air fryer. If using frozen fillets, make sure to thaw them before cooking, or add a few extra minutes to the cooking time.

It is also important to select fillets that are similar in size and thickness so that they cook evenly. Look for fillets that are roughly equal in size and weight, around 4oz (113g) each. This will ensure that they cook at the same rate and you don't end up with some overcooked and others undercooked.

When purchasing your tilapia fillets, opt for sustainably sourced fish whenever possible. Tilapia is often farmed sustainably, making it a great choice if you're concerned about the environmental impact of your seafood choices. Check for labels or certifications that indicate sustainable fishing practices.

Finally, consider the flavour and texture you're looking for in your dish. Tilapia is known for its mild flavour and slightly meaty and firm texture. If you prefer a stronger flavour, you might want to choose a different type of fish, such as salmon or cod. However, the mild flavour of tilapia makes it a versatile option that can be seasoned and served in a variety of ways to suit your taste preferences.

Seasoning and marinating

For seasoning, a simple combination of salt and pepper can be used, or you can add garlic powder and smoked paprika for a more complex flavor. You can also add chili powder and lime for a spicy kick. Mix your chosen seasonings in a bowl and rub them onto both sides of the fillets. Alternatively, you can whisk the oil and seasonings together and brush or coat the fillets with this mixture.

If you want to add an extra crispy texture, you can coat the fillets with panko or regular breadcrumbs before placing them in the air fryer.

Preheating the air fryer

Preheating your air fryer is an important step in cooking tilapia fillets. While some recipes do not require preheating, it is generally recommended to ensure even cooking and to prevent the fillets from drying out.

To preheat your air fryer, start by turning it on and setting the temperature. The ideal temperature for preheating your air fryer for tilapia fillets is between 375°F and 400°F (190°C to 200°C). Depending on the model of your air fryer, the preheating time can vary from 2 to 3 minutes. For example, a medium-sized 6.8-quart air fryer typically takes 2 minutes to preheat.

During the preheating process, it is a good idea to prepare your tilapia fillets. This includes patting them dry with paper towels and applying any desired seasonings or coatings. You can also use this time to prepare the air fryer basket by lightly spraying it with cooking spray, such as olive oil spray, to prevent the fish from sticking.

Once the preheating is complete, you can proceed to place the seasoned tilapia fillets into the air fryer basket, ensuring they are in a single layer without overcrowding the basket. This helps maintain even cooking and allows the hot air to circulate effectively.

By preheating your air fryer, you create an optimal cooking environment for your tilapia fillets, ensuring they cook evenly, retain moisture, and develop a nice colour on both sides.

Cooking time and temperature

The cooking time and temperature for air fryer tilapia fillets vary depending on the thickness of the fillets and the type of air fryer used. It is recommended to preheat the air fryer for 2-3 minutes at 375F/190C-200C/400F. Then, cook the fillets for 6-10 minutes at the same temperature until they are cooked to your desired level of doneness.

For a 4oz fillet, the ideal internal temperature for moist, flaky tilapia is 140°F-145°F, which can be measured using a meat thermometer. If you are using frozen fillets, it is recommended to add an extra 3 minutes to the cooking time.

It is important to note that you should not overcrowd the air fryer basket and it is okay if the fillets touch, but make sure they don't overlap. Depending on the size of your air fryer, you may need to cook the fillets in batches to ensure even cooking.

Frequently asked questions

It takes 6-10 minutes to cook tilapia fillets in an air fryer. The cooking time depends on the thickness of the fillets and the type of air fryer used.

Preheat your air fryer to 375°F-400°F (190°C-200°C). Then, cook the tilapia fillets at the same temperature.

The tilapia fillets are done when they are golden brown and crispy on the outside, and tender and flaky on the inside. You can also use a meat thermometer to check if the internal temperature of the thickest part of the fillet has reached 140°F-145°F.

Yes, you can cook frozen tilapia fillets in an air fryer. However, it will take a little longer to cook. You can cook the frozen fillets without thawing them, but it is recommended to add an extra 3 minutes to the cooking time.
